![]() I'd definitely go ceramic coated... it's worth the extra dough IMHO. You'll thank yourself in about 2-3 years when they still look great compared the discolored or even flaky chrome plating, it has the tendency to bubble and flake and then rusty away much quicker than the ceramic coating.
Overall the ceramic coating just holds up alot better over time, looks better IMHO, and dissipates heat much quicker than chrome (it's also called a thermal barrier btw). If the headers you choose are coated inside and out, even better, not sure which companies only coat the outside... just ask before you buy. I know the Dynomax shorty headers I had were coated inside and out... not sure about the Bassani long-tubes I run now, but it looks like they do also... no idea on the BBK's, but they probably do as well. The one piece flange that bolts to the heads is supposed to be better...
